Search in sources :

Example 6 with PluginConfigurationManager

use of org.infernus.idea.checkstyle.config.PluginConfigurationManager in project checkstyle-idea by jshiell.

the class CodeStyleImporterTest method setUp.

@Override
protected void setUp() throws Exception {
    super.setUp();
    PluginConfigurationManager mockPluginConfig = mock(PluginConfigurationManager.class);
    final PluginConfiguration mockConfigDto = PluginConfigurationBuilder.testInstance("8.0").build();
    when(mockPluginConfig.getCurrent()).thenReturn(mockConfigDto);
    when(project.getService(PluginConfigurationManager.class)).thenReturn(mockPluginConfig);
    csService = new CheckstyleProjectService(project);
    codeStyleSettings = CodeStyleSettingsManager.createTestSettings(CodeStyleSettings.getDefaults());
    javaSettings = codeStyleSettings.getCommonSettings(JavaLanguage.INSTANCE);
}
Also used : PluginConfigurationManager(org.infernus.idea.checkstyle.config.PluginConfigurationManager) PluginConfiguration(org.infernus.idea.checkstyle.config.PluginConfiguration) CheckstyleProjectService(org.infernus.idea.checkstyle.CheckstyleProjectService)

Aggregations

PluginConfigurationManager (org.infernus.idea.checkstyle.config.PluginConfigurationManager)6 PluginConfiguration (org.infernus.idea.checkstyle.config.PluginConfiguration)4 CheckstyleProjectService (org.infernus.idea.checkstyle.CheckstyleProjectService)2 Project (com.intellij.openapi.project.Project)1 ConfigurationLocation (org.infernus.idea.checkstyle.model.ConfigurationLocation)1 ConfigurationLocationFactory (org.infernus.idea.checkstyle.model.ConfigurationLocationFactory)1 Before (org.junit.Before)1 BeforeClass (org.junit.BeforeClass)1